Mister Lincoln Rose Bush Lighting Needs|Bright indirectOne of the most well known and top ten in fragrance of the Hybrid Tea roses, he features long pointed buds which open into large, well formed, long stemmed, very full, 4" blooms of the deepest red. The velvety texture of the bloom is almost unbelievable. Mister Lincoln has an outstandingly strong damask fragrance that seduces the senses.
